SYNTHESIS AND CHARACTERIZATION OF SCHIFF BASE TRANSITION METAL COMPLEXES

Abstract

New metal complexes of cu(II); Ni(II); Co(II); Mn(II); Zn(II); VO(IV) and Cd (II) have been synthesized from the Sciff base (L) derived from 4-amino antipyrine,salicyaldehyde and O-phenylene diamine. The prepared complexes where characterized by magnetic susceptibility, Molar conductance,FTIR,Uv-vis. The data show that these complexes have composition of ML type. The uv-vis,magnetic susceptibility data of the complexas suggest asquare-planar geometry around the central metal ion except VO(IV )complex which has square-pyramidal geometry.
